LOADING IMDG CONTAINERS

 

bullet Check DG note, DG manifests are provided.
bullet Vessel to be given proposed stowage plan.
bullet Check if segregation requirements are met.
bullet Check marking, labeling and placarding of the containers are in good condition.
bullet Damaged or leaked containers will not be accepted.
bullet Keep combustible materials away from sources of ignition.
bullet Stow in places not liable to damage or heating.
bullet Stow in a position so that the contents may be moved/jettisoned in case of any emergency.
bullet Naked lights and smoking is prohibited in or near DG areas.
bullet Fire fighting appliances are kept ready to deal with possible fire.
bullet Protective clothing and SCBA sets to be available.
bullet Bunkering, hot work, use of radar or radio transmitters to be stopped, especially if the cargoes are explosive type.
bullet If possible, the operation to be in daylight hours. At night, adequate lightings to be provided.
bullet Ambient temperature in relation to the flash point to be taken into account.
bullet Any spillage to be carefully dealt with, taking into consideration the nature of the substance.
bullet Consult EMS and MFAG in case of any accident involving DG.
bullet Once containers are loaded, location od DG containers to be counterchecked with the bay plan.
